  • Closed Accounts Posts: 32,688 ✭✭✭✭ytpe2r5bxkn0c1


    Mysurveys take forever to earn enough to cash out as rewards are tiny but they are legit.
    Red C pay well but surveys can be months apart and you have to reach €50 to receive your rewards.


  • Registered Users Posts: 2,801 ✭✭✭bmc58


    Hi SRW,
    I would recommend Red C Live.I have been a member for18 mths and get regular surveys of 1e to 4e.Got one for 5e yesterday.Got 2 payouts of 50e no problem.Cheque arrived within 10days.Would recommend without hesitation.Surveys might be a week apart or you may get 3 in a week.
    One word of caution though,at the end of the survey you are asked some profile questions about "how many adults and children under and over 18"live in your house.Make sure that you put the same answers in the correct boxes that you entered at the start of the survey.
    I messed up the under/over 18 question in a couple early surveys I done and the survey was just cancelled even though it was just a simple error.
    No other problems.RED C is fine by me.
